The Medical Group Certified Athletic Trainer is responsible for the treatment and documentation of outpatients in the clinical setting along with other duties as required in the orthopedic clinic setting, operating room assisting, and covering local high school sporting events on occasion.
Volume in each setting depends on positions. Takes call on a rotational basis.

License / Certification
Must have a current Certification in Athletic Training (ATC) from the NATABOC. Must have a valid state license or registration or valid temporary permit as a Certified Athletic Trainer, issued by the Oregon State Athletic Trainer Licensing Board.
BLS certification is required through American Heart Association. Valid driver's license and auto insurance required.
Education and / or Experience
Must have successfully completed a program culminating with a bachelor’s degree or higher from an accredited school. The Medical Group Certified Athletic Trainer will have completed an orthopedic or other relevant residency program.
